July 21 (CRICKETNMORE) - Mohammad Sami of Pakistan and Mark Chapman of New Zealand will join St Lucia Stars squad for the 2018 Hero Caribbean Premier League (CPL). CPL 2018 Schedule

Chapman will replace Hussain Talat in the Stars squad after he became unavailable for this year’s Hero CPL. Chapman made his international debut for his native Hong Kong in 2015 but he has subsequently moved to New Zealand and has also represented them at international level against England this winter.

Mohammad Sami will replace Rumman Raees who is also no longer available. Sami is one of the most experienced quick bowlers on the T20 circuit and has previous experience at Hero CPL having played for the Jamaica Tallawahs in 2017. Sami has played for Pakistan in 87 ODIs and 13 T20 Internationals and has claimed 169 wickets in his T20 career.
